What's the best time of year to play golf in Glarus Süd?
We recommend visiting Glarus Süd between late May and early October for the best playing conditions and breathtaking alpine views. Outside of these months, you'll find the course either closed or battling unpredictable mountain weather, which isn't ideal for a relaxing round.
Is it worth traveling to Glarus Süd for just one golf course?
Absolutely, yes. While Glarus Süd only offers one course, Golf Glarnerland, it's a fantastic mountain track that makes the journey worthwhile. Expect challenging elevation changes and stunning panoramas on every hole, a truly unique Swiss golf experience you won't soon forget.
What can I expect to pay for a round of golf at Golf Glarnerland?
A round at Golf Glarnerland typically ranges from CHF 80-120, depending on the day and time you play. We found booking online in advance often secures a slightly better rate, and don't forget to factor in a cart if you're not keen on walking the hilly terrain.

How challenging is Golf Glarnerland for different skill levels?
Golf Glarnerland presents a fair challenge for most golfers, but don't underestimate the mountain layout - it demands accuracy and smart club selection. Beginners will enjoy the scenery, while experienced players will appreciate the strategic shot-making required, especially on the uphill and downhill holes.
